Dutch National Ballet…. is based in Amsterdam, Netherlands. Over the past 59 years, the Dutch National Ballet has evolved into one of the world's foremost ballet companies, with a unique and wide repertoire. With around 80 dancers from all over the world and a tradition of innovation, the company plays a leading role in Dutch cultural life and beyond.
G-Star RAW… also based in Amsterdam, designed the Tutu for the concept of the time in which we now live… socially distanced by government directive, for the health and safety of ourselves and others. G-Star RAW constructed the Tutu in all denim, which is emblematic of their brand. For 31 years, the military inspired clothing company has used denim to develop ready to wear apparel for all genders.
Most recently, G-Star RAW publicly made a commitment to be one of the most sustainable denim brands on the planet. In 2016, they partnered with Plastic Soup Foundation to stop the use of microfibers in clothing. “A fleece releases an incredible 1 million microfibers every time it is washed. If you imagine that every day a couple of billion people around the world wash their clothing and that almost every item of clothing contains plastic nowadays, you can easily see why it is imperative to deal with this cause of the plastic soup immediately. G-Star RAW is the first fashion brand that recognizes and supports the need for innovation.” This is the making of the impressive, diameter of 3 meters*, G-Star RAW TuTu for the Safe Distance Ballet with Dutch National Ballet this year.

And this is G-Star RAW and Dutch National Ballet showcasing the culmination of their unique collaboration: the universal ‘new reality’, social distancing, visualized through Art. Safe Distance Ballet choreography was inspired by the empty theaters, Artists who don’t have a stage and the movement of each individual finding their way in this new normal. To make Art together… our socially distanced society still moves through each Artistic expression: music (DJ Joris Voorn), dance (Dutch National Ballet), design (G-Star RAW) and production (The Family Amsterdam).
